“Sambhal mosque will no longer remain Waqf property, cries Owaisi: Read the provisions of the Waqf Amendment Act that prevent encroachment of ASI monuments”, Opindia, April 6, 2025:
“On 4th April, All India Majlis-e-Ittehadul Muslimeen (AIMIM) chief Asaduddin Owaisi stated that once the Waqf (Amendment) Bill becomes an Act, Jama Masjid in Sambhal will no longer be a Waqf property. Owaisi was speaking to Sandeep Chaudhary during an interview on ABP News.
He said that under Section 3D of the Waqf (Amendment) Act, any property protected under ASI cannot be a Waqf property, which includes the Sambhal mosque and several other Islamic structures across the country.
Citing the Ram Mandir judgement of the Supreme Court, Owaisi claimed that the apex court accepted the claim over land by user. However, according to the new Act, the concept of user will be applicable only if the land is not disputed or not government property…….”
